White House defends aide, fires back at House GOP

Published May 12, 2016

Associated Press

The White House is defending a senior aide over recent comments he made about the Iran nuclear deal.

White House spokesman Josh Earnest says the White House is reviewing a request for deputy national security adviser Ben Rhodes to testify before the House oversight committee. The committee's chairman has asked Rhodes to testify Tuesday about whether he and other allies made false claims about the deal.

But Earnest says if Republicans want to investigate misstatements, they should call some Republicans to testify.

He says several GOP lawmakers were either "wildly wrong or lying" when they made claims about the deal's economic benefits for Tehran

At issue are Rhodes' comments in a New York Times Magazine piece.
